Chobani is a food maker with a mission of making high-quality and nutritious food accessible to more people, while elevating our communities and making the world a healthier place. In short: making good food for all. In support of this mission, we are a values-driven, people-first, food-and-wellness-focused company, and have been since Hamdi Ulukaya, an immigrant to the U.S., founded the company in 2005. We produce yogurt , oatmilk , dairy- and plant-based creamers , ready-to-drink coffee and plant-based probiotic drinks . Chobani yogurt is America's No.1 yogurt brand, and it’s made with only natural ingredients without artificial preservatives. Chobani uses food as a force for good in the world – putting humanity first in everything we do. Our philanthropic efforts prioritize giving back to our communities and beyond: working to eradicate child hunger, supporting immigrants, refugees and underrepresented people, honoring veterans, and protecting the planet. read more

Chobani Collections Manager Salaries in Buffalo, NY

The average Chobani Collections Manager in Buffalo, NY earns an estimated $81,185 annually. Chobani's Collections Manager compensation is $14,661 more than the US average for a Collections Manager.

In Buffalo, NY, The Finance Department at Chobani earns $17,994 more on average than the Customer Support Department.

Collections Manager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Collections Manager at companies similar size to Chobani reported making $76,498, while the average male Collections Manager at similar sized companies reported making $68,500.

Collections Manager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Hispanic or Latino Collections Manager at companies similar size to Chobani reported making $87,000, while the average Caucasian Collections Manager at similar sized companies reported making $64,686.
